According to insights from Future Data Stats, the Patient Monitoring Devices Market was valued at USD 55.10 billion in 2025. It is expected to grow from USD 60.80 billion in 2026 to USD 119.40 billion by 2033, registering a CAGR of 10.1% during the forecast period (2026–2033).

RECENT DEVELOPMENTS:
- In March 2026 – FDA clears AliveCor’s KardiaMobile 6L with AI-based atrial fibrillation detection, enabling 30-day continuous patch-less monitoring for home users.
- In February 2026 – Masimo launches SafetyNet Alert wearable platform, integrating real-time SpO₂ and respiratory rate alerts directly to hospital EMR systems.
- In December 2025 – Medtronic acquires remote monitoring startup BioIntelliSense, adding disposable adhesive sensors for post-discharge vital sign tracking.
- In October 2025 – Philips receives CE mark for Patient Information Center iX (PIC iX) with predictive early-warning score algorithm for sepsis detection.
- In August 2025 – GE HealthCare unveils Portrait Mobile wireless continuous monitoring solution for general ward patients, reducing ICU transfers by 22% in trials.
COMPETITOR OUTLOOK:
The patient monitoring devices market remains consolidated among large medtech firms aggressively expanding into wearable, wireless, and AI-driven platforms. Medtronic, Philips, and GE HealthCare lead with integrated hospital-to-home solutions, while Masimo and Nihon Kohden focus on sensor accuracy and niche parameters like CO-oximetry. Start-ups are being acquired for remote monitoring algorithms, intensifying R&D competition in predictive analytics and low-power connectivity.
Emerging players from Asia, including Mindray and Omron, are gaining share via cost-effective multiparameter monitors and aggressive distribution in emerging economies. Regulatory shifts toward decentralized care and reimbursement for virtual wards drive partnerships between monitor vendors and telehealth providers. Success now depends on seamless EMR integration, cybersecurity compliance, and real-time clinical decision support, not just hardware reliability.
